304-12411 Lansdowne Drive NW
304-12411 Lansdowne Drive NW is a residence located in Edmonton, in the area of Lansdowne.
Request more information
304-12411 Lansdowne Drive NW is a residence located in Edmonton, in the area of Lansdowne.